Why render_svg_widget needs a policy

This tool creates and generates SVG widget content (reversible output artifacts). It does not execute arbitrary code, delete data, move money, or trigger external side effects beyond producing visual assets. It fits the Write category—content creation that can be modified or removed without destructive consequences. The blast radius of misuse is minimal (unwanted SVG generation in a README).

From the tool's definition Tool name 'render_svg_widget' and description 'Generates extremely high-fidelity glassmorphic SVG cards' indicate creation of SVG assets. The verb 'Generates' paired with 'renders' shows content creation, not data retrieval or external execution.

How to control render_svg_widget

PolicyLayer is an MCP gateway — it sits between your AI agents and GodProfile MCP Toolkit, and nothing reaches the server without passing your rules. This is the rule we recommend for render_svg_widget:

policy.json
{
  "version": "1",
  "default": "deny",
  "tools": {
    "render_svg_widget": {
      "limits": [
        {
          "counter": "render_svg_widget_rate",
          "window": "minute",
          "max": 30,
          "scope": "grant"
        }
      ]
    }
  }
}

render_svg_widget stays usable, but capped — an agent stuck in a loop can't make hundreds of changes a minute. Everything else on the server is denied unless you say otherwise.

Questions about render_svg_widget

What does the render_svg_widget tool do? +

Generates extremely high-fidelity glassmorphic SVG cards with 12px borders. It is categorised as a Write tool in the GodProfile MCP Toolkit MCP Server, which means it can create or modify data. Consider rate limits to prevent runaway writes.

How do I enforce a policy on render_svg_widget? +

Register the GodProfile MCP Toolkit MCP server in PolicyLayer and add a rule for render_svg_widget: allow, deny, rate-limit, or require approval. Point your MCP client at the PolicyLayer proxy URL and the rule is enforced on every call, before it reaches GodProfile MCP Toolkit. Nothing to install.

What risk level is render_svg_widget? +

render_svg_widget is a Write tool with medium risk. Write tools should be rate-limited to prevent accidental bulk modifications.

Can I rate-limit render_svg_widget?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the render_svg_widget r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block render_svg_widget complet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for render_svg_widget.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.

What MCP server provides render_svg_widget? +

render_svg_widget is provided by the GodProfile MCP Toolkit MCP server (luc0-0/godprofile). PolicyLayer sits as a proxy in front of this server to enforce policies before tool calls reach the server.
